虎课网为您提供字体设计版块下的[python程序的打包]python程序-15章 在Mac上打包python程序图文教程,本篇教程使用软件为Python(3.6.7),难度等级为初级练习,下面开始学习这节课的内容吧!
那就开始学习吧!
1.本节课分享python零基础入门-第十五章-Python程序的打包-3.在Mac上打包python程序,有问题的同学可以在评论区留言。
2.学习MAC系统上学习Python程序的打包,以sha256程序为例,使用PyInstaller,进行打包。
3.首先Python执行sha256的程序,先进到第17章里面,通过Python,执行sha256输入文件的名字,计算文件本身得到Hash值。
4.在安装装PyInstaller之前,先创建虚拟环境,通过python venv,创建【env】的虚拟环境。
5.通过source,进到虚拟环境里面,做一个activate,通过pip把PyInstaller去安装,先进到第17章里面,然后打包sha256.py。
6.通过PyInstaller,在sha256.py里面会出现Permission denied,原因是因为需要使用sudo,通过sudo pyinstaller开始打包。
7.打包的结果和Windows系统的结果是类似的,生成一个dist的目录,py文件输入,打包成一个文件夹。
8.如果需要打包成一个可执行文件,先把dist目录删除,通过sodu参数 ,加【-F】的参数。
9.在pyinstaller的时候,进行-F就会生成可执行文件,而不是文件夹。
10.本节课的内容就分享到这了,同学们记得根据所学内容完成作业,评论区上传自己的作业哦!
以上就是[python程序的打包]python程序-15章 在Mac上打包python程序图文教程的全部内容了,你也可以点击下方的视频教程链接查看本节课的视频教程内容,虎课网每天可以免费学一课,千万不要错过哦!